81
£2,820.71

Subtotal: £2,820.71

View basketCheckout

Get FREE delivery on all orders!

81
£2,820.71

Subtotal: £2,820.71

View basketCheckout

Editor Picks

Home Garden Page 8

Garden

Showing 1105 – 1116 of 1183 results